In highschool a friend and I build a multiplication circuit based on an AMV serving as clock frequency driver, pushing binary numbers A and B through an addition circuit and a latch producing the result A*B.
We freaked out when we were able to increase the frequency from 1Hz where we visually could see the calculation proceed via LEDs, to thousands of Hz and "instant" calculation.
We had to physically hit the manual begin-switch with great force, in order to prevent the switch from not going cleanly from 0 to control voltage, when we operated in the KHz clock frequencies.
